## Deploying the Gatewick Proctor Queue

Deploys are pretty painless: push to main, wait for the pipeline, then watch the queue drain dashboard for five minutes. If candidates pile up mid-exam, roll back first and ask questions later — the queue replays safely. Everything the workers care about lives in one config block, shown here for reference.

settings of bafof-yagef:
JOROX_PIN=8740
JOROX_TENANT=pelox
JOROX_METRICS_HOST=metrics.jorox.qorvelworks.internal
JOROX_SEAL=seal_c78f63c1
JOROX_STANDBY_TEAM=norax

Handover: Exportron retry queue

Hi Mira — handing over the failed-export retries. Exports that hit a timeout land in the retry queue and get three attempts with backoff; after that they're parked and need a manual requeue from the admin panel. Watch for customers reporting duplicates — that usually means a double requeue. The current retry settings are as follows.

settings of bajog-fawig:
oliael:
  log_level: warn
  metrics_host: metrics.oliael.zemvarsys.internal
  pin: 0267
  pool_size: 32

Budget Request — FY Uplift (Managers Only)

Page prepared for the incoming director.

Summary: Operations has requested a 12% uplift for the Drayfield processing unit. Covers two analyst hires, replacement of the Corvex sorting rig, and contingency for the Hollis Lane lease renewal. Prior-year spend ran 4% under plan. Decision needed before the planning freeze in week six. Pending items tracked on the finance board. The underlying rationale is recorded below.

confidential, yawif-fadup: The southern region missed its Eliius quota by 61.1 percent last quarter. Istixax Freight plans to raise the Jorwyn list price by 65.7 percent in October. The board signed off on a budget of $445.3 million for Project Ulaox. The renewal with Briathax Partners closes at $41.0 million a year, 49.9 percent below the last contract.